M3-Florida State University falls to M3-Georgia University of in overtime, 4-3 (OT) TBD Sat, Oct 11, 2014 Michael Falkenstein gave M3-Georgia University of a 4-3 (OT) victory over M3-Florida State University when he scored 4:13 into the extra period. M3-Georgia University of was sparked by Falkenstein, who had one goal. In the losing effort, M3-Florida State University was paced by Robert Kaplove, who finished with two goals. Kaplove scored the first of his two goals on the power play at 2:00 into the first period to make the score 1-0 M3-Florida State University. M3-Florida State University had taken the advantage when M3-Georgia University of's Lucas Warner got sent off for interference. Walter Stern picked up the assist. Kaplove's next tally on the power play made the score 3-3 with 6:11 left in the third period. Eric Campbell provided the assist. Others who scored for M3-Georgia University of included Zach Flasch, Alex Carey, and Eric Mauge, who each put in one. More assists for M3-Georgia University of came via Stephen Bray, David Bakin, and Cameron Gilmore, who each chipped in one. M3-Florida State University forced its penalty killing units to work especially hard during the game, picking up six minors and one major for 27 minutes in penalty time. M3-Florida State University surpassed its season average of 20.0 penalty minutes per game. Justin Soukup also scored for M3-Florida State University. Other players who recorded assists for M3-Florida State University were Nicholas Granger and Matthew Mchugh, who contributed one each. M3-Georgia University of totaled 23 minutes in penalty time with four minors and one major and went 1-for-5 on the power play. M3-Florida State University registered one goal on three power play opportunities.
